Meanwhile, in news, Lancashire Police is under scrutiny for releasing private information about a missing person's personal struggles. Former Director of Public Prosecutions, Sir Keir Starmer, expressed discomfort over the release, emphasizing the importance of investigators focusing on facts rather than speculation. In political news, talks between the UK government and the Democratic Unionist Party (DUP) over the Northern Ireland Protocol have made progress, but the DUP insists they will not compromise on their red lines regarding trade implications and constitutional concerns.

      Betrayal of national security comes with severe consequences, as evidenced by the 13-year prison sentence handed to former British embassy security guard David Smith for selling secrets to Russia. Meanwhile, on the frontlines of war, the devastation and injuries faced by soldiers continue to shock medical professionals, with Dr. Andy Kent, a British surgeon in Ukraine, sharing his experiences of treating wounded soldiers with external fixators due to shell injuries.
